This is an Easy One.

First of all, you can download on another computer the internet driver. for this you will need to know what driver you are using. do this:

On your device manager, right click Network Controller and click Properties.
Then go to details tab, and change it to Hardware ID, this will give you the controller ID, now just uses google to find what maker and driver it, if you have troubles, just past the hardware ID here, and ill post you the driver.

There are also several software that install the wifi driver when you dont have one, however, will avoid that for now.

Once you got Wifi on your laptop, you can search for your laptop model and search the drivers on the website, OR, you an use IOBIT driver booster, Driver Genius, or whatever software you decide, or you can just let Windows Update search for them. or activate windows update and it will install all the missing components.

The N means Windows doesn’t have Windows Media Player so you’ll need to buy it separately if you want it.

The features in the N and KN Editions are the same as their equivalent full versions, but do not include Windows Media Player or other Windows Media-related technologies, such as Windows Media Center and Windows DVD Maker. The cost of the N and KN Editions are the same as the full versions, as the Media Feature Pack for Windows 7 N or Windows 7 KN can be downloaded without charge from Microsoft.
